Rome2Rio

How to get fromPorto to Assisiby plane, bus, train or car

Find Transport to Assisi

See all options

There are 11 ways to get from Porto to Assisi by plane, bus, train, or car

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Fly to Perugia Sant'Egidio Airport

    best
    1. Fly from Francisco De Sá Carneiro Airport (OPO) to Perugia Sant'Egidio Airport (PEG)plane plane OPO - PEG
    9h 48m
    €131–376
  2. Fly to Fiumicino International Airport, train

    cheapest
    1. Fly from Francisco De Sá Carneiro Airport (OPO) to Fiumicino International Airport (FCO)plane plane OPO - FCO
    2. Take the train from Roma Termini to Folignotrain train
    10h 34m
    €63–215
  3. Bus, train

    1. Take the bus from Porto to Vigobus bus
    2. Take the train from Vigo Urzaiz to Madrid Chamartíntrain train Ave
    3. Take the train from Madrid-Puerta de Atocha-Almudena Grandes to Perpignantrain train
    4. Take the bus from Perpignan to Florencebus bus
    5. Take the bus from Florence Villa Constanza Bus Station to Assisibus bus 529
    31h 9m
    €173–383
  4. Drive 2,205.4 km

    1. Drive from Porto to Assisicar car 2,205.4 km
    21h 35m
    €342–494
  5. Fly to Florence Peretola Airport, train

    1. Fly from Francisco De Sá Carneiro Airport (OPO) to Florence Peretola Airport (FLR)plane plane OPO - FLR
    2. Take the train from Firenze S.M.N. to Assisitrain train
    11h 55m
    €91–262
  6. Fly to Bologna Guglielmo Marconi Airport, train

    1. Fly from Francisco De Sá Carneiro Airport (OPO) to Bologna Guglielmo Marconi Airport (BLQ)plane plane OPO - BLQ
    2. Take the train from Bologna Centrale to Florence Santa Maria Novellatrain train
    3. Take the train from Firenze S.M.N. to Assisitrain train
    11h 12m
    €100–274
  7. Fly to Pisa International Airport, train

    1. Fly from Francisco De Sá Carneiro Airport (OPO) to Pisa International Airport (PSA)plane plane OPO - PSA
    2. Take the train from Pisa Centrale to Firenze S.M.N.train train
    3. Take the train from Firenze S.M.N. to Assisitrain train
    11h 28m
    €105–289
  8. Fly to Raffaello Sanzio Airport, train

    1. Fly from Francisco De Sá Carneiro Airport (OPO) to Raffaello Sanzio Airport (AOI)plane plane OPO - AOI
    2. Take the train from Jesi to Folignotrain train
    14h 24m
    €95–289
  9. Bus

    1. Take the bus from Porto to Marseillebus bus
    2. Take the bus from Marseille - Saint-Charles Bus Station to Florence Villa Constanza Bus Stationbus bus
    3. Take the bus from Florence Villa Constanza Bus Station to Assisibus bus 529
    35h 30m
    €113–312
  10. Bus via Toulouse

    1. Take the bus from Porto to Toulousebus bus
    2. Take the bus from Toulouse to Florence Villa Constanza Bus Stationbus bus
    3. Take the bus from Florence Villa Constanza Bus Station to Assisibus bus 529
    35h 35m
    €81–264
  11. Bus #2

    1. Take the bus from Porto - Terminal Intermodal de Campanhã to Valladolidbus bus
    2. Take the bus from Valladolid Central Bus Station to Milano, Autostazione Lampugnanobus bus
    3. Take the bus from Milano, Autostazione Lampugnano to Perugia Train Station Bus Stopbus bus
    44h 45m
    €147–247

Porto to Assisi by bus and train

Calendar5Weekly Services
Duration31h 9mAverage Duration
Ticket€173Cheapest Price
See schedules

Questions & Answers

What companies run services between Porto, Portugal and Assisi, Italy?

Ryanair and Vueling Airlines fly from Francisco De Sá Carneiro Airport (OPO) to Perugia Sant'Egidio Airport (PEG) 4 times a week. Alternatively, you can take a bus from Porto to Assisi via Marseille - Saint-Charles Bus Station and Florence Villa Constanza Bus Station in around 35h 30m.

Airlines
Train operators
Bus operators

Want to know more about travelling around Italy

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ides

Italy Travel Guides

Read the travel guideItaly Travel Guides

More Questions & Answers